I have become fond of Japanese knives lately and wanted to get some steak knives in that style without paying $100.00 a piece so I ordered this Ginsu Koga set. The knives I received didn't have an etched blade but did have the extra detailing on the handle that is not on the Chikara set. Actually my set says "Marquee Series" on one side and is stamped "china" on the other. The name Ginsu is nowhere to be found on the knife. The set did come in the bamboo case shown which is fairly nice. The factory edge is a blunt convex grind which is somewhat sharp. I presume this edge geometry is to help retain the edge for those who don't sharpen their knives. The handle is not a traditional "D" handle but a flattened oval which will work for either right or left handed persons. I'm going to keep this set since I was more interested in the handle detailing than the etched blade.
